According to CBS News, on January 16 local time, the family of renowned American director David Lynch announced his passing at the age of 78.
Lynch Profile Photo The Guardian
The report stated that Lynch’s family released a statement on his social platform announcing his death, saying, “He is no longer with us, and the world feels emptier; however, as he always said, ‘Focus on the donut, not the hole.’ The weather is wonderful today, with a golden sunshine and blue skies all the way.”
It was mentioned that Lynch would have turned 79 on January 20. In August 2024, he revealed that he had been diagnosed with emphysema after many years of smoking.
It is known that Lynch directed numerous Hollywood films and series, with representative works such as ‘Blue Velvet’ and ‘Twin Peaks.’
